1. Stay True to Yourself
One of the most important pieces of advice for aspiring fashion bloggers comes from Tavi Gevinson, who emphasizes the importance of authenticity. She advises, “Write about what you care about and don’t worry about trends or what other people are buzzing about at the moment.” Authenticity shines through in your writing, and readers can easily tell when you’re passionate about your content. When you genuinely care about what you’re sharing, your blog will be exciting and engaging. On the other hand, forcing yourself to write about topics you’re not interested in can make your content feel uninspired.
2. Find Your Voice
Developing a consistent voice is key to building a recognizable brand in the fashion blogging world. Noelle Downing of Noelle’s Favorite Things suggests, “Try to be as consistent as you can and make sure your content—whether it’s on Instagram or your blog—is cohesive and true to you.” Your voice is what sets you apart from other bloggers, so take the time to define it and make sure it reflects your personality and style. Consistency in your tone, style, and content will help you build a loyal audience who knows what to expect from your blog.
3. Keep It Up
Consistency doesn’t just apply to your voice—it’s also crucial in your posting schedule. Noelle Downing encourages aspiring bloggers to “post regularly and don’t give up!” She warns that taking long breaks between posts can lead to disappointment among your readers and cause you to lose their attention. Regular posting keeps your audience engaged and helps build momentum for your blog. Whether it’s once a week or a few times a month, find a posting schedule that works for you and stick to it.
4. Draw Inspiration from Your Network
Arabelle of Fashion Pirate credits much of her success to the support and inspiration she received from her friends. She says, “It was their unintentional encouragement that got me to where I am today,” and notes that the friendships and experiences she’s gained through blogging have been some of the most significant aspects of her journey. Building a network of fellow bloggers and fashion enthusiasts can provide you with invaluable support, inspiration, and opportunities for collaboration.
